
Site Reliability Engineer II, Payments Technology
JPMorgan Chase5 hours ago
Singapore, SingaporeMid Level
Responsibilities
- Own and operate critical payment services and cloud infrastructure to ensure availability, resiliency, performance, and operational stability.
- Drive monitoring, observability, incident management, problem management, and continuous service improvements.
- Use Datadog, CloudWatch, and enterprise observability tooling to detect, diagnose, and prevent customer-impacting issues.
- Lead incident recovery, conduct root cause analysis, and implement permanent corrective actions.
- Automate operational processes and develop self-healing capabilities to eliminate toil.
- Improve service-level indicators, objectives monitoring, alerting, and reliability transparency.
- Apply authorized AI capabilities to incident triage, troubleshooting, runbook drafting, and post-incident analysis with appropriate validation and data controls.
- Develop expertise in payment transaction flows and identify reliability risks across the payment lifecycle.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Cybersecurity, Data Science, or a related discipline.
- At least 2 years of formal training or certification in software engineering concepts.
- Ability to code in at least one programming language.
- Experience maintaining cloud-based infrastructure and familiarity with site reliability concepts and practices.
- Experience with observability and monitoring tools and techniques.
- Experience using AWS and integrating it with Datadog.
- Working knowledge of enterprise-authorized AI capabilities for SRE workflows, including validating recommendations for correctness, risk, resiliency, security, and auditability.
- Exposure to ITIL processes and continuous integration and continuous delivery practices and tooling.
- Preferred: public cloud experience and AWS Certification.
- Preferred: experience in banking and payment domains, including SWIFT, real-time payments, FX cross-currency, payment clearing, or partner bank systems.
- Ability to collaborate across geographies, manage complex requirements, and adapt to changing priorities.

About JPMorgan Chase
JPMorgan Chase provides consumer and commercial banking, payments, credit card, wealth management, and corporate and investment banking services to individuals, businesses, institutions, and governments. The public company (NYSE: JPM) earns revenue from interest, fees, trading, and asset management across operations in more than 100 markets. Headquartered in New York City with roots dating to 1799, it serves retail customers and prominent corporate and government clients through brands including Chase and J.P. Morgan.
